Oracle_For_AIX安装手册_oracle数据库安装手册
Oracle_For_AIX安装手册由刀豆文库小编整理,希望给你工作、学习、生活带来方便,猜你可能喜欢“oracle数据库安装手册”。
文档编号:
Oracle/WAS For AIX安装
部署手册
2010年8月
厦门中软海晟信息技术有限公司
系统集成安装手册
1.oracle数据库安装
本章节主要讲述AIX环境下ORACLE 10g的安装和升级过程。
1.1.安装前的检查和准备工作
1.1.1.介质准备
准备安装文件(cpio、tar等格式),升级补丁等软件介质,FTP上传安装文件到小机目录,也可以制作成光盘。
1.1.2.检查操作系统版本
#oslevel-r 6100-03 1.1.3.检查必须的软件包安装情况
主要是Java、X11、xlC等软件包的版本
#lslpp-l X11.apps.rte X11.apps.xterm X11.base.rte X11.motif.lib X11.motif.mwm
Fileset
Level State
Description
--------------Path: /usr/lib/objrepos
X11.apps.rte
6.1.3.0 COMMITTED AIXwindows Runtime
Configuration Applications
X11.apps.xterm
6.1.3.1 COMMITTED AIXwindows xterm Application
X11.base.rte
6.1.3.1 COMMITTED AIXwindows Runtime Environment
X11.motif.lib
6.1.3.0 COMMITTED AIXwindows Motif Libraries
系统集成安装手册
X11.motif.mwm
6.1.3.0 COMMITTED AIXwindows Motif Window
Manager
Path: /etc/objrepos
X11.apps.rte
6.1.3.0 COMMITTED AIXwindows Runtime
Configuration Applications
X11.base.rte
6.1.3.0 COMMITTED AIXwindows Runtime Environment
#lslpp-l.proctools bos.adt.prof bos.cifs_fs.rte
root@fjly-yydb:/>lslpp-l bos.adt.prof bos.cifs_fs.rte xlC.aix50.rte xlC.rte
Fileset
Level State
Description
--------------Path: /usr/lib/objrepos
bos.adt.prof
6.1.3.0 COMMITTED Base Profiling Support
bos.cifs_fs.rte
6.1.3.0 COMMITTED Runtime for SMBFS
xlC.rte
10.1.0.2 COMMITTED XL C/C++ Runtime
Path: /etc/objrepos
bos.cifs_fs.rte
6.1.3.0 COMMITTED Runtime for SMBFS
#lslpp-l | grep java
Java14.ext.java3d
1.4.2.0 COMMITTED Java SDK 32-bit Java3D
Java14.ext.javahelp
1.4.2.0 COMMITTED Java SDK 32-bit JavaHelp
Java14_64.ext.javahelp
1.4.2.0 COMMITTED Java SDK 64-bit JavaHelp
Java5.ext.java3d
5.0.0.175 COMMITTED Java SDK 32-bit Java3D
cluster.adt.es.java.demo.monitor
mqm.java.rte
6.0.0.0 COMMITTED WebSphere MQ Java Client, JMS
#lslpp-l | grep xlC
root@fjly-yydb:/>lslpp-l | grep xlC
xlC.aix61.rte
10.1.0.2 COMMITTED XL C/C++ Runtime for AIX 6.1
xlC.cpp
9.0.0.0 COMMITTED C for AIX Preproceor
xlC.msg.en_US.cpp
9.0.0.0 COMMITTED C for AIX Preproceor
系统集成安装手册
xlC.msg.en_US.rte
10.1.0.2 COMMITTED XL C/C++ Runtime
xlC.rte
10.1.0.2 COMMITTED XL C/C++ Runtime
xlC.sup.aix50.rte
9.0.0.1 COMMITTED XL C/C++ Runtime for AIX 5.2
1.1.4.检查文件系统情况
是否有足够空间安装oracle
root@fjly-yydb:/>df-g Filesystem
GB blocks
Free %Used
Iused %Iused Mounted on /dev/hd4
10.00
9.80
3%
14464
1% / /dev/hd2
10.00
7.35
27%
54721
4% /usr /dev/hd9var
10.00
9.63
4%
7527
1% /var /dev/hd3
10.00
8.86
12%
2101
1% /tmp /dev/hd1
10.00
9.99
1%
1% /home /dev/hd11admin
0.50
0.50
1%
1% /admin /proc
-/proc /dev/hd10opt
30.00
25.28
16%
30128
1% /opt /dev/livedump
0.50
0.50
1%
1% /var/adm/ras/livedump /dev/lv_ftp
40.00
17.78
56%
7355
1% /ftp /dev/lv_hsmis
300.00
197.06
35%
1% /hsmis
1.1.5.检查换页空间
root@fjly-yydb:/>lsps-a Page Space Physical Volume Volume Group Size %Used Active Auto Type Chksum hd6
hdisk0
rootvg
10240MB
yes
yes
lv
0 1.1.6.更改系统参数
smitty chgsys
系统集成安装手册
Maximum number of PROCESSES allowed per user >= 2048 smitty aio AIX parameters:
--only applicable to file system based configs minservers=100 maxservers=100 maxreqs=16384
1.1.7.设置内存参数
vmo-p-o lru_file_repage=0 vmo-p-o minperm%=5 vmo-p-o maxclient%=12 vmo-p-o maxperm%=15 vmo-p-o strict_maxperm=0 vmo-p-o strict_maxclient=1
1.2.UXIX环境下的安装步骤
1.2.1.创建用户和用户组
用户oracle 用户组:oinstall/dba Oracle用户同时加入这两个用户组(oracle如果没有加入dba组,安装后oracle用户使用会有问题)
1.2.2.编辑oracle用户的.profile文件
添加环境申明
系统集成安装手册
export DISPLAY=10.188.181.179:0.0 export ORACLE_HOME=/opt/oracle/product/10.2.0/db_1 export ORACLE_BASE=/opt/oracle umask 022 export PATH=$HOME/bin:$ORACLE_HOME/bin:$PATH export ORACLE_SID=yymis
1.2.3.安装介质所在目录权限设置
更改安装文件和升级补丁的用户和属组,同时开启执行权限
chown-R oracle:oinstall /path chmod-R +x /path
1.2.4.开放/opt 和 /home目录的写权限
假设oracle安装在/opt目录
#chmod 777 /opt #chmod 777 /home 1.2.5.安装包解压
cpio-idmcv
进入Disk1---rootpre目录 #./rootpre.sh
系统集成安装手册
./rootpre.sh output will be logged in /tmp/rootpre.out_09-11-27.14:32:33 Kernel extension /etc/pw-syscall.64bit_kernel is loaded.Unloading the existing extension: /etc/pw-syscall.64bit_kernel....Oracle Kernel Extension Loader for AIX
Copyright(c)1998,1999 Oracle Corporation
Unconfigured the kernel extension succefully Unloaded the kernel extension succefully Saving the original files in /etc/ora_save_09-11-27.14:32:33....Copying new kernel extension to /etc....Loading the kernel extension from /etc
Oracle Kernel Extension Loader for AIX
Copyright(c)1998,1999 Oracle Corporation
Succefully loaded /etc/pw-syscall.64bit_kernel with kmid: 0x4458c00 Succefully configured /etc/pw-syscall.64bit_kernel with kmid: 0x4458c00 The kernel extension was succefuly loaded.Configuring Asynchronous I/O....Asynchronous I/O is already defined
Configuring POSIX Asynchronous I/O....Posix Asynchronous I/O is already defined
Checking if group services should be configured....Nothing to configure.系统集成安装手册
1.2.7.使用远程虚拟终端
打开Xmanager,连到小机
系统集成安装手册
1.2.8.进入图形化安装界面
进入Disk1目录,运行runInstaller
#./runInstaller 此时Xmanager会出现图形化安装界面,安装过程与pc机类似,注意环境检测界面所有都要 PASS!
选择Enterprise Edition(3.40GB),点击next。
系统集成安装手册
name项输入数据库名,Path项输入安装路径,如“opt/oracle /product/10.2.0”
Oracle对操作系统的依赖库文件检查,必须Status要全部都是“Succeeded”,如果有失败的情况必须找出缺少哪个系统库文件,退出安装程序重新安装所需的操作系统库文件。
系统集成安装手册
选择只安装数据库软件“Install database Software only”
系统集成安装手册
点击INSTALL开始安装
系统集成安装手册
1.2.9.安装成功后运行两个脚本
注意,必须以root用户执行脚本
/oracle/oraInventory/orainstRoot.sh # /oracle/oraInventory/orainstRoot.sh
Changing permiions of /oracle/oraInventory to 775.Changing groupname of /oracle/oraInventory to oinstall.The execution of the script is complete
/oracle/product/10.2.0/db_1
# /oracle/product/10.2.0/db_1/root.sh
Running Oracle10 root.sh script...The following environment variables are set as:
ORACLE_OWNER= oracle
系统集成安装手册
ORACLE_HOME= /oracle/product/10.2.0/db_1
Enter the full pathname of the local bin directory: [/usr/local/bin]: Creating /usr/local/bin directory...Copying dbhome to /usr/local/bin...Copying oraenv to /usr/local/bin...Copying coraenv to /usr/local/bin...Creating /etc/oratab file...Entries will be added to the /etc/oratab file as needed by Database Configuration Aistant when a database is created
Finished running generic part of root.sh script.Now product-specific root actions will be performed.1.2.10.安装升级包
Oracle安装完成后,要打升级补丁,将其升级到10.2.0.4版本。
进入oracle_p6810189_10204_AIX5L---Disk1,运行runInstaller,等待升级成功
系统集成安装手册
安装软件自动识别已安装Oracle软件目录,点击“Next”继续。
安装程序会校验所需系统库文件包是否存在,点击“Next”继续。
系统集成安装手册
取消选择“Enable Oracle Configure Manager”,点击”Next”继续
点击“Install”开始安装补丁软件
系统集成安装手册
1.2.11.重新运行一遍root.sh 升级完毕后,重新运行一遍root.sh
# /oracle/product/10.2.0/db_1/root.sh
系统集成安装手册
Running Oracle10 root.sh script...The following environment variables are set as:
ORACLE_OWNER= oracle
ORACLE_HOME= /oracle/product/10.2.0/db_1
Enter the full pathname of the local bin directory: [/usr/local/bin]: Creating /usr/local/bin directory...Copying dbhome to /usr/local/bin...Copying oraenv to /usr/local/bin...Copying coraenv to /usr/local/bin...Creating /etc/oratab file...Entries will be added to the /etc/oratab file as needed by Database Configuration Aistant when a database is created
Finished running generic part of root.sh script.Now product-specific root actions will be performed.1.2.12.安装完成检查服务是否正常后,就可以开始创建数据库了。